Journal of the Brazilian Chemical Society | 2007

Trihaloisocyanuric acids/NaX: an environmentaly friendly system for vicinal dihalogenation of alkenes without using molecular halogen

Suellen D. F. Tozetti; Leonardo S. de Almeida; Pierre M. Esteves; Marcio C. S. de Mattos

The reaction of alkenes with easily handled trihaloisocyanuric acids / NaX in aqueous acetone produces the corresponding vicinal dihaloalkanes in moderate to excellent yields.
